The Ultimate Guide to the Aquarium Volume Calculator in Gallons: How to Measure Your Tank Accurately
Establishing a brand-new aquarium is an amazing undertaking. Whether planning a rich planted freshwater scape or a dynamic marine reef, the extremely first step every enthusiast must take is identifying the specific water volume of the tank. Knowing the aquarium volume in gallons is not simply a matter of interest; it is important for calculating proper stocking levels, administering medications accurately, dosing water conditioners, and determining filtration requirements.
While makers typically stamp a "small" gallon size on a tank, these numbers can in some cases be misinforming. Factors such as glass thickness, internal overflows, contoured glass fronts, and decorating substrates can substantially modify the actual water capacity.
This detailed guide explores the mathematics behind aquarium volume, the different tank shapes, and why using a reliable aquarium volume calculator in gallons is vital for success.
Why Knowing Your Exact Aquarium Volume Matters
Before diving into the solutions, it helps to understand why accuracy is so crucial in the fishkeeping pastime. Water is the life support system of aquatic life, and maintaining steady chemical parameters requires exact measurements.
- Medication Dosing: Overdosing medications can easily prove fatal to fish and invertebrates, while underdosing can render treatments ineffective versus pathogens and parasites. A lot of medication guidelines require precise gallon measurements.
- Water Treatment & & Conditioners: Dechlorinators, pH buffers, and general fertilizers are developed for specific gallon increments. Accurate volume computations prevent chemical imbalances.
- Stocking Limits: The timeless "one inch of fish per gallon" guideline is dated, but enthusiasts still rely heavily on gallon metrics to compute biological load and prevent overstocking.
- Devices Sizing: Heaters, filters, and protein skimmers are rated based upon water volume. An undersized filter will have a hard time to preserve water quality, while an oversized heating system can trigger dangerous temperature level variations.
Standard Aquarium Shapes and Formulas
To compute the volume of an aquarium, one should apply basic geometry. Since liquids take the shape of their containers, calculating water volume relies on measuring the interior measurements of the tank (length, width, and height) instead of the outside, that includes glass thickness and plastic rims.
1. Rectangle-shaped Aquariums
The most typical and simple style.
- The Formula: ₤ text Volume (Gallons) = frac text Length (in) times text Width (in) times text Height (in) 231 ₤
- Note: Dividing by 231 converts cubic inches into United States liquid gallons.
2. Bow-Front Aquariums
Bow-front tanks provide a breathtaking viewing experience due to their curved front glass. Because the front panel juts external, basic rectangle-shaped solutions will underestimate the overall volume.
- The Formula: To discover the volume of a bow-front tank, determine the volume as if it were a standard rectangular shape using the typical depth (the average of the shallowest side width and the inmost center width).
3. Cylinder Aquariums
Round tanks supply 360-degree viewing angles and make striking centerpieces in a space.
- The Formula: ₤ text Volume (Gallons) = frac pi times r ^ 2 times text Height (in) 231 ₤
- Where: ₤ r ₤ is the radius (half of the diameter) of the cylinder.

To accomplish the most accurate reading with an aquarium volume calculator in gallons, enthusiasts need to follow a step-by-step measuring procedure:
- Measure the Interior: Using a measuring tape, determine the inside length, inside width, and the height of the water line (not the overall height of the glass).
- Transform to Inches: If measurements were taken in centimeters, transform them by dividing by ₤ 2.54 ₤. (For centimeters, the divisor modifications to ₤ 3,785 ₤ to discover gallons, or you can determine in liters first and multiply by ₤ 0.264 ₤ to transform to United States gallons).
- Increase the Dimensions: Multiply Length ₤ times ₤ Width ₤ times ₤ Water Height.
- Divide by 231: Divide the resulting cubic inch product by ₤ 231 ₤.
Example Calculation:
Imagine a custom-made tank with an interior length of ₤ 36 ₤ inches, a width of ₤ 18 ₤ inches, and a water height of ₤ 20 ₤ inches.
- ₤ 36 times 18 times 20 = 12,960 text cubic inches ₤
- ₤ 12,960 div 231 = 56.1 ₤ gallons.
Aspects That Reduce Actual Water Volume
When the physical volume of the empty tank is calculated, it is simple to assume that is just how much water goes within. Nevertheless, internal hardscape and equipment displace water. Failing to account for displacement can cause unintentional over-dosing of medications or water treatments.
Common aspects that displace water consist of:
- Substrate: A two-inch layer of aquarium gravel, sand, or aqua soil in a big tank can displace a number of gallons of water.
- Hardscape: Large pieces of driftwood, lava rock, and dragon stone take up a surprising quantity of area inside the aquarium.
- Backgrounds and 3D Structures: Internal background panels add depth and charm, however they push water displacement levels greater.
- Equipment: Internal filters, heating systems, and overflow boxes lower the general liquid capacity.
The "Substrate and Hardscape" Estimation Rule
As a general guideline, heavy decors, dense substrates, and rockwork usually decrease total tank water volume by 10% to 15%. For example, if a bare tank holds 100 gallons, the real water volume in a heavily aquascaped setup might just be around 85 to 90 gallons.
